People Score in 32960, Vero Beach, Florida

The People Score for the Alzheimers Score in 32960, Vero Beach, Florida is 8 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 78.43 percent of the residents in 32960 has some form of health insurance. 39.58 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 52.70 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 32960 would have to travel an average of 1.74 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Arubah Neuroscience Institute Pllc. In a 20-mile radius, there are 3,196 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 32960, Vero Beach, Florida.

**Local Wellness Programs: A Network of Support**

The presence of robust local wellness programs is a critical indicator of community health. 32960 is fortunate to have a network of organizations dedicated to promoting health and well-being, including those specifically focused on Alzheimer's care and support.

Imagine the dedicated staff and volunteers at the Alzheimer & Parkinson's Association of Indian River County. They offer support groups, educational programs, and respite care for families affected by these devastating diseases. Their work is invaluable, providing a lifeline for those navigating the challenges of cognitive decline.
